Willie Miller pinpoints the precise instant in which Celtic defeated Aberdeen in the Parkhead demolition: “They lost their faith.”
At Parkhead, Celtic secured their second-largest victory of the season over Aberdeen. Earlier this season, the Bhoys defeated Aberdeen 6-0 in the League Cup.
However, at Celtic Park last night, Brendan Rodgers’ Bhoys completely destroyed the Pittodrie club. Jimmy Thelin’s team exhibited a commendable effort in the initial half and, in reality, should have taken the lead earlier due to Celtic’s sluggish start.
However, the Hoops eventually demonstrated their sophistication and gradually reversed the tide to secure a 5-1 victory over Aberdeen, which left Jimmy Thelin in a state of disarray at Celtic Park.
However, it appears that there was a moment when The Dons simply surrendered inside Paradise, which did not sit well with BBC commentator and Aberdeen legend Willie Miller.
